Skydance Announce Marvel 1943: Rise of Hydra Delayed to 2026

Skydance New Media has confirmed that Marvel 1943: Rise of Hydra, the upcoming narrative-driven superhero adventure led by Amy Hennig, will now launch in early 2026, missing its original 2025 release window.

According to the team on social site X/Twitter, the extra development time is being used to refine the experience, suggesting a push toward cinematic quality and seamless gameplay integration.

The announcement follows a surge of interest after the game’s spotlight at GDC 2024, where Epic’s State of Unreal event offered a glimpse into its atmospheric 1940s wartime setting.

Built in Unreal Engine 5 and supported by MetaHuman Animator for facial realism, Marvel 1943 is positioning itself as a narrative powerhouse among Marvel’s expanding game portfolio.

Four Heroes, One War

Set during the height of World War II, Marvel 1943 brings together four distinct protagonists, each with personal stakes in the fight against Hydra:

  • Steve Rogers / Captain America – Portrayed by Drew Moerlein, this version of Cap is younger, more impulsive, and just stepping into the role of a leader.
  • Azzuri / Black Panther – Voiced by Khary Payton, Azzuri is T’Challa’s grandfather and a formidable king forced to fight far from Wakanda to protect his people’s future.
  • Gabriel Jones – Played by Marque Richardson, Jones is a Howling Commando on the ground in occupied Paris, offering a soldier’s perspective on the war.
  • Nanali – A Wakandan spy embedded in the heart of the conflict, voiced by Megalyn Echikunwoke, Nanali moves in the shadows, uniting tech and espionage.

What sets Marvel 1943 apart is how these characters, despite aligned goals – clash due to cultural differences and conflicting methods.

The tension between Captain America and Black Panther becomes a driving force in the story, as ideological friction gives way to reluctant camaraderie.

Much of the narrative unfolds in occupied Paris, with Hydra’s presence complicating both Nazi operations and the Allied resistance.

This backdrop allows for high-stakes infiltration, urban combat, and espionage-driven sequences.

The choice of Paris is not just aesthetic, it serves as a living, breathing environment steeped in historical conflict and layered allegiances.

The creative team, led by Amy Hennig (best known for Uncharted), is crafting an experience that blends character-driven storytelling with gameplay moments reflective of each hero’s strengths.

While Captain America leans into raw physicality and shield combat, Azzuri offers a more agile, predator-like approach. Nanali’s stealth missions and Gabriel Jones’ grounded gunplay diversify the moment-to-moment gameplay loop.

Casting and Voice Talent

The game’s voice cast brings gravitas and emotional weight to the characters:

  • Drew Moerlein – Steve Rogers / Captain America
  • Khary Payton – Azzuri / Black Panther
  • Marque Richardson – Gabriel Jones
  • Megalyn Echikunwoke – Nanali
  • Joel Johnstone – Howard Stark

Each character benefits from detailed facial capture thanks to MetaHuman Animator, a tool enabling subtle expressions and lifelike performances.

Though delayed, Marvel 1943: Rise of Hydra is expected to make a reappearance soon, possibly with fresh gameplay or a story deep-dive.

With other Marvel projects in development, including Arkane Lyon’s Blade and EA’s Iron Man and Black Panther, Skydance’s offering remains one of the most narratively ambitious in the current Marvel games slate.

Fans may be disappointed by the delay, but early signals suggest the extra time is being used for meaningful improvements rather than just damage control.

If Skydance pulls it off, Marvel 1943: Rise of Hydra could stand among the most compelling Marvel video game adaptations to date.
